History Is A Tool For The Future

October 20, 2010 by admin Leave a Comment

  Have you ever considered the importance of studying history not to to just learn the stories but to learn where and why something went wrong? So many times we get caught up in knowing the stories in history that we forget the main reason in learning from our past to possibly prevent something in our future.

 The Lord gives us the stories in the Old Testament to teach us how to be alert spiritually to evil and to recognize something in sin that can develop in us to divert the path that we are on. In Genesis 4 the Lord taught us this lesson before everything else with Cain and it was recorded for our own recognition to prevent something from consuming us to the point that it can destroy us. 

 History is a great tool when we know how to apply it to our lives today without becoming stuck in it to the point that we miss the lesson in it. The same evil spirits that have taken down men and women in history are the same spirits that attack us today. Don’t be fooled and think that history is only history because if you really pay attention to the times you will find that history tends to repeat itself until the people learn how to walk with Jesus to reach the other side…amen

Make Godly Decisions

October 18, 2010 by admin 2 Comments

 Making a life changing decision is not something that should be rushed nor made without seeking Godly council to help us insure the steps that we take. So many times we allow our emotions to misguide us in our decisions due to the temptations of our own desires that eventually have a negative impact on someone else.

 To simplify our decisions without over complicating our answers we should ask ourselves this question,”Is this decision being led by God?” If we can answer this question without hesitation and acknowledge the commitment that we are making then we are on the Way to something better in building something for someone else rather than ourselves.

 Often when we hesitate in our decisions it is because we are unsure and we have not taken the proper time in seeking the council of God to insure the steps that we take. This is why our divorce rate is so high in America and children are without their parents due to parents acting in their emotions without thinking about the future. It is vital that we take the time to seek God before we make changes that can affect the future. For if our decisions only serve our self then we are making the wrong that will eventually hurt someone else…

 Jesus taught us to look beyond what we see to hear what needs to be heard to insure the steps that we take…

Pray Before You Act…

September 29, 2010 by admin Leave a Comment

 There is something very important for us to recognize in the difference between acting in our emotions and being led in the Spirit. Our emotions are easily deceived when we do not know how to recognize the Spirit of God and the Spirit of Satan. Spiritually Satan preys in our emotions and often causes us to act in ways that we later regret. This is why it is so important for us to study the Word of God to receive the discernment in the spirits to see beyond our current emotions and to learn how to place our trust in God instead of in man.

 This lesson of our human nature was taught in the crucifixion of Jesus Christ with the crowd that murdered our Lord and Savior. They fell to acting in their emotions without trusting in God to work it all out. The same thing happens in our life today of jumping to conclusions without seeking the council of God to guide us in our trials in life. Have you ever acted in your emotions and later regretted something you may have said or that you may have done? I challenge you today to analyze your emotions before you act to insure that you later won’t be hanging from a tree due to the decisions which you make…amen

Search For The Climate Of God

September 9, 2010 by admin Leave a Comment

 Have you ever noticed how we tend to get stuck in a season and when the ripple of change comes our way we tend to miss what God has instore. It is in our human nature to search for that fixed climate because we tend to adapt to the environment that we are in and we often lean on the security of what we think that we know.

 This flaw in our human nature which derives from sin is exactly what caused many of the Israelites to miss the Messiah when He came. The Word of God teaches us to always be alert because we never know where God will be working next and so many times we allow ourselves to get stuck in what we see that we forget what God teaches us in how to believe.

 Change is a beautiful thing that is taking place all around us and when we begin to look for God in the seasons of change is when He will begin to motivate our lives to appreciate the seasons to come…amen
